    The 2nd Shift Disassembly/Assembly Technician is a full-time, on-site position based in Fort Lauderdale, Florida. This role is primarily focused on facilities-related duties, including maintaining a clean, safe, and organized work environment, supporting equipment setup and breakdown, and ensuring work areas meet safety and operational standards. In addition, the technician is responsible for disassembling, cleaning, inspecting, and tagging aircraft components, while actively identifying opportunities to improve processes, safety, quality, and overall efficiency.

    Responsibilities:

    • Complex production assembly operations on structural and mechanical assemblies, subassemblies and aircraft systems, equipment, and accessories using manual operations.
    • Follows approved assembly procedures for component or aircraft structures, consulting internal procedures that have been FAA approved, original equipment manufacturers (OEM's) technical data, and work package instructions.
    • Utilization of comprehensive knowledge of aircraft mechanical component troubleshooting/repair procedures and replacement of components.
    • Thorough knowledge of aircraft structural modification and repair and the ability to determine the functionality of non-complex electrical systems.
    • Operation of unique aircraft tools such as test equipment, torque wrenches, dial indicators, micrometers, cable tensiometers, sheet metal brakes, sheers, etc.
    • Applies professional technical expertise and guidance to execute complex structures work, including but not limited to pull holes, match & back drilling, fastener removals, riveting, sleeve bolt drilling, and system, wire, and tube installations.
    • Reads and interprets engineering drawings, technical orders, process specifications, and retrofit requirements to perform structural modification/repair.
    • Maintains necessary certifications, licenses, and permits as required for assigned work.

    Qualifications:

    • 2+ years of experience removing and restoring aircraft assemblies.
    • Must have a minimum of a high school education or equivalent and 1 to 3 years of related experience or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
    • Experience assembling aircraft/aerospace parts, components, and/or assemblies using applicable drawings, specifications, quality standards, and manufacturing plans.
    • Possess the ability to construct, install, dismantle, relocate, modify, and/or repair OEM equipment of all types.
    • Knowledge of wiring schematics on understanding and reading a manual to install components.
